Overview of the Marantz Cinema 40
The Marantz Cinema 40 is a high-performance 11.4-channel AV surround amplifier designed to deliver immersive home theater experiences. It features 9 channels of 125-watt amplification‚ 8K video upscaling‚ and support for advanced audio formats like Dolby Atmos and DTS:X. With its sleek‚ minimalist design and iconic porthole display‚ the Cinema 40 combines elegance with cutting-edge technology. Priced lower than premium competitors like the Arcam AVR31‚ it offers exceptional value with its robust feature set. The amplifier supports multi-zone audio‚ Dirac Live room correction‚ and seamless integration with smart home systems. Its connectivity options include HDMI 2.1‚ ensuring compatibility with the latest 8K devices. Built for both power and precision‚ the Cinema 40 is ideal for audiophiles seeking a comprehensive home theater solution.
Key Features of the Marantz Cinema 40
The Marantz Cinema 40 boasts an array of advanced features‚ making it a standout in home theater systems. It supports 8K video upscaling‚ ensuring crisp and detailed visuals‚ and is equipped with 9 channels of 125-watt amplification‚ delivering powerful and immersive sound. The amplifier is compatible with Dolby Atmos‚ DTS:X‚ and Auro-3D for a three-dimensional audio experience. It also features Dirac Live room correction and Audyssey MultEQ for precise sound calibration. With multi-zone support‚ users can enjoy audio in up to three separate zones. The Cinema 40 includes HDMI 2.1 ports‚ eARC‚ and wireless connectivity options like AirPlay and Wi-Fi. Its sleek design‚ including a porthole-style display‚ adds a touch of elegance to any room. These features combine to create a premium home theater experience tailored for audiophiles and movie enthusiasts alike;

Using Audyssey Setup
Audyssey Setup is a powerful tool designed to optimize your audio experience. It calibrates your system by analyzing the acoustics of your room and adjusting settings for the best sound quality. To use Audyssey‚ connect the included microphone to the Marantz Cinema 40 and follow the on-screen instructions. The system will emit test tones to measure speaker levels‚ distances‚ and frequency response. After completing the calibration‚ Audyssey automatically adjusts settings to ensure balanced and immersive sound. For advanced users‚ Audyssey offers additional customization options to fine-tune the audio to your preferences. Refer to the manual for detailed steps and troubleshooting tips to ensure optimal performance from your Audyssey Setup.
Dirac Live Room Correction
Dirac Live Room Correction is an advanced calibration tool designed to optimize your audio system’s performance by analyzing and correcting for the acoustic characteristics of your room. To use Dirac Live‚ navigate to the setup menu on your Marantz Cinema 40 and select the Dirac Live option; Connect the provided calibration microphone to the unit and follow the on-screen instructions to begin the measurement process. The system will analyze the room’s acoustics and automatically adjust settings for optimal sound quality. Dirac Live complements Audyssey calibration‚ offering precise adjustments for frequency response and time alignment. This feature ensures a more immersive and accurate listening experience‚ tailored to your specific environment. Refer to the manual for detailed steps and troubleshooting tips to maximize the benefits of Dirac Live Room Correction.

Cleaning the Unit
To maintain the Marantz Cinema 40’s performance and appearance‚ regular cleaning is essential. Use a soft‚ dry cloth to gently wipe the exterior‚ avoiding harsh chemicals or abrasive materials that could damage the finish. For stubborn marks‚ lightly dampen the cloth with distilled water‚ but ensure it is not soaking wet to prevent moisture damage. Avoid spraying liquids directly onto the unit or its vents‚ as this could harm internal components.
For internal cleaning‚ such as dust buildup in vents or fans‚ use compressed air sparingly and at a safe distance. Never insert objects into openings‚ as this could cause damage. Cleaning should be done with the unit powered off and unplugged for safety. Regular maintenance ensures optimal functionality and preserves the unit’s aesthetic appeal. Always handle the device with care to maintain its high performance and longevity.
